Choose Your Sanctuary Style



The centerpiece of any type of glamping configuration is the structure itself. This is where you set the tone for your entire experience, so choose something that blends comfort with personality.

Bell Tents



Bell tents are the classic glamping choice for good factor. Their spacious round impact and high facility post enable genuine furniture-- think beds, rugs, and side tables-- without feeling confined. Canvas product maintains the interior breathable in summertime and surprisingly warm on cool nights. A top quality 5-meter bell outdoor tents can easily rest two adults with room to save for decoration.

Geodesic Domes



For something a lot more remarkable, a geodesic dome provides a futuristic visual with unbelievable architectural stamina. Numerous come with clear panels, transforming the ceiling right into an online stargazing window. They stand up well in wind and rainfall, making them a wise long-term investment if you intend to utilize your glamping setup throughout multiple periods.

High-end Safari Tents



If you wish to go all out, platform-mounted safari outdoors tents bring real boutique hotel power to your backyard. Raised wood decks, zip-out wall surfaces, and covered patios make these feel much less like camping and more like an exclusive rental property-- just with much better air.

Create a Bed Well Worth Sleeping In



Nothing divides glamping from camping faster than the sleeping scenario. Ditch the resting bag and invest in a correct bed framework or a raised cot with a thick cushion topper. Layer it with hotel-quality bed linen, a beefy knit toss, and a minimum of three pillows per person. Add a battery-powered bedside light and a tiny tray with publications or a candle for that finishing store touch. Your visitors-- or you-- should seem like taking a look at in the morning is truly challenging.

Establish the Mood with Lights and Decoration



Lighting is the solitary most powerful device in your glamping toolkit. String warm Edison light bulb fairy lights across the outdoor tents ceiling, wrap them around neighboring trees, and line pathways with solar-powered lanterns. Inside the camping tent, mix flooring lanterns with column candles (use flameless LED variations for safety) to produce layers of cozy, golden light that really feel magical after dark.

For style, lean right into natural structures-- jute carpets, rattan trays, wooden pet crates repurposed as side tables, and potted plants placed around the entryway. Hang a little macramé piece or a framed agricultural print on the camping tent wall. The objective is curated, not littered.

Build a Cozy Outdoor Living Location



A real luxury glamping experience extends beyond the camping tent. Develop an outdoor lounge location with weatherproof elbow chairs or a seat, a low coffee table, and a fire pit or chiminea as the prime focus. Surround the area with potted lavender or rosemary for scent, and include a couple of outdoor-safe throw coverings curtained over the seating for chilly nights.

If your spending plan enables, a small wooden deck beside the tent boosts the entire configuration and keeps mud away during damp weather. Also a set of stepping rocks and a basic outdoor carpet can specify the space without significant construction.

Do Not Forget the Small Luxuries



The details are what visitors remember long after the experience ends.

Morning meal Basket



Leave a wicker basket filled with fresh fruit, breads, coffee sachets, and a tiny thermos near the outdoor tents entryway the evening before. It's a straightforward gesture that feels unbelievably indulgent.

Exterior Shower or Bathing Terminal



A solar camp shower hung from a tree branch, bordered by best tent stoves a simple bamboo display, includes a spa-like dimension to your site. Stock it with natural soaps and a cosy towel on a wood hook.

A Personal Touches Checklist



Think of a welcome note, a hand-drawn map of the backyard with little points of interest, a playlist on a mobile Bluetooth audio speaker, and a s'mores kit next to the fire pit. These zero-cost enhancements develop the kind of unforgettable, individual experience that no resort can quite duplicate.
